New to thread - I keep burning out new fog hid ballasts instantly upon installation

I have the cheap ebay hid fogs and my drivers side has always worked fine. A few months ago my passenger ballast blew and when I replaced it, the bulb lights up upon initial testing. I should note I hear ballast buzzing from that passenger ballast upon testing however the bulb does light. After testing the connection a few more times before installation the electrical buzzing noise will remain in the passenger ballast and on the 2nd or 3rd attempt the entire ballast fries. Thought maybe a bad ballast, tried 2 more new ones and same thing happened. I know the bulb is good on the passenger side and I know the ballast is getting fried each time before I swap it to the drivers side (the working side) and it won't power anything on.


I have a new ballast and I really would like to avoid frying this one. Any help would be appreciated.
